90min reports that Chelsea is set to sign Brighton wonderkid Zak Sturge. He is also wanted by Tottenham Hotspur and Leeds.

After he refused to sign a contract at the Amex Stadium, Antonio Conte and Jesse Marsch both wanted to sign the 18 year-old. However, it is believed that Thomas Tuchel is close to a deal and the pair seem to have lost out.

He is now ready to discuss personal terms and the Blues.

Chelsea will need to pay a compensation fee to Brighton, despite Sturge being a free transfer. This is because he is a product of their Academy.

Sturge represented England at youth level and has made three appearances in Premier League 2.

Although it is a shame that Tottenham missed out on such a bright prospect they should not be too disappointed considering the immediate options in the left-back department.

Spurs have recently signed Ivan Perisic to their team. He was a star left-winger for Inter Milan last year.

Conte may also use Sergio Reguilon and Ryan Sessegnon in this area.

However, Leeds needs a new left back in Marsch's situation.

Junior Firpo was unsuccessful in his first season in the Premier League. There is very little competition for the 25 year-old.

You may argue that Sturge wouldn’t be able to walk right into the first-team. However, it is easy to see how much talent is still lingering at Premier League academies by looking at Marc Guehi, Armando Broja and Conor Gallagher.

Marsch will hopefully soon find a left-back.
